Q-omics provides the consensus-scored HLX-AS1 profile across patient tissues and cancer cell-line models. HLX-AS1 expression is associated with patient survival in 21 of 34 cancer types, with the highest sampling consensus in ESCA. Among the 18 cancer types available for tumor–normal comparison, HLX-AS1 is differentially expressed in 12, with the highest sampling consensus in COAD. Additionally, HLX-AS1 RNA expression shows 14,539 significant gene co-expression associations, with the highest sampling consensus in UVM. Together, these results highlight ESCA, COAD, and UVM as cancer lineages where HLX-AS1 shows reproducible signals across survival, tumor–normal expression, and patient cross-omics analyses.

Every result is evaluated using two consensus scores. Sampling consensus measures how consistently a finding is reproduced within a cancer lineage across different conditions. Lineage consensus measures how broadly the result is shared across cancer types, distinguishing pan-cancer signals from lineage-specific patterns.

This table ranks reproducible HLX-AS1 RNA expression–survival associations across cancer types. High HLX-AS1 expression shows unfavorable associations in LUSC and THCA, but favorable associations in ESCA, LUAD, KIRC and HNSC. The ESCA Kaplan–Meier curve shows clear separation, with the low-expression group declining faster, consistent with the favorable association (log-rank p = .002). Together, the overview and detailed table identify ESCA as the clearest survival context for HLX-AS1 RNA expression.

This table ranks reproducible tumor–normal expression differences for HLX-AS1. A negative fold-change indicates higher expression in normal tissue than in tumor tissue. HLX-AS1 shows lower tumor expression in COAD, LUSC, THCA, LUAD, BLCA and KICH. The COAD box plot shows higher HLX-AS1 RNA expression in normal versus tumor tissue (log2 FC = −0.343, t-test p < 0.001).
